The Anglo-Saxon name Rudy comes from the family having resided in Rudyard, Staffordshire. The place-name Rudyard means "yard where rue was grown" derived from the Old English words rude + geard.

Is Rudy a rare name?
Rudy was the 860th most popular boys name and 6856th most popular girls name. In 2020 there were 261 baby boys and only 16 baby girls named Rudy. 1 out of every 7,017 baby boys and 1 out of every 109,440 baby girls born in 2020 are named Rudy.

32 related questions foundWhat is Rudy a nickname for?
Short version of Rudolf, which comes from Rudolphus, the Latinized version of the name hrodwulf from the Germanic hrod, meaning "fame" and wulf, meaning "wolf". Rudy is the nickname of Rudolph Giuliani, the former Mayor of New York.
